InvestorGain
investorgain.com
India‑focused IPO & primary‑markets portal with live IPO subscription tracking, Grey Market Premium (GMP) dashboards, anchor investor allocations, and new‑issue calendars (NCDs, SGBs, rights). Provides broker reviews/comparisons and free brokerage calculators. GMP is expressly noted as based on market perception/public sources; the site states it does not work with GMP operators and content is for education/news. The business is ad/affiliate‑supported.

Khan Academy (Economics & Finance)
khanacademy.org
Completely free courses in microeconomics, macroeconomics, finance, capital markets, and personal finance. No certificates are awarded. Mobile apps support offline video, practice exercises, and progress sync across devices.
